Join hands-on tree survey to help increase Oakland’s canopy

Join Pitt’s Office of Sustainability and Tree Pittsburgh for a hands-on tree survey and training from 9 a.m. to noon March 28.

The event is designed for Pitt students, employees and Oakland residents. Participants will meet at 630 William Pitt Union.

Participants will learn:

  • How to evaluate sidewalks for tree planting potential

  • Key considerations like power and gas lines, ADA accessibility, and sidewalk stability

  • Hands-on experience surveying Oakland neighborhoods and mapping potential tree sites

  • How collected data will support future tree planting efforts through the Oakland Planning and Development Corporation

A large portion of this workshop takes place outdoors and involves walking — please dress for the weather.
